Budget Queen Posted February 7, 2017 #6 Share Posted February 7, 2017 I never get a porter either. I also just walk down 12th Ave to 42nd/ Circle Line and take the 42 bus to Port Authority. If you don't have a Metrocard (use the same method to get there, buy the Metrocard at the Port Authority subway station, load with all the rides needed, one card) then you need $2,75 in COIN.
